A rental management executive has collected data on square footage and monthly rental fee for 80 apartments in her city. The data are in file XR02045. Considering square footage as the independent variable and monthly rental fee as the dependent variable:
a. Generate a scatter diagram that includes the best-fit linear equation for these data.
b. Does there appear to be any relationship between the variables? If so, is the relationship direct or inverse?
c. Interpret the slope of the equation generated in part (a).
d. Viewing the scatter diagram and equation in part (a), do you think there are any apartments that seem to have an unusually high or an unusually low rental fee compared to what would be pre- dicted for an apartment of their size? Are there any variables that are not included in the data that might help explain such a differential? If so, what might they be?
